Devuan bug report logs - #793
Xorg libseat needs to handle duplicate file descriptors.

version graph

Package: xserver-xorg-core; Maintainer for xserver-xorg-core is Devuan Developers <devuan-dev@lists.dyne.org>; Source for xserver-xorg-core is src:xorg-server.

Reported by: Fran Vazquez <fran42@gmx.es>

Date: Wed, 30 Aug 2023 19:32:01 UTC

Severity: normal

Tags: moreinfo

Found in version 2:21.1.7-3devuan2~exp1

Fixed in versions 2:21.1.8-1devuan2, 2:21.1.7-3devuan2

Done: dak@devuan.org

Full log


Message #48 received at 793@bugs.devuan.org (full text, mbox, reply):

Received: (at 793) by bugs.devuan.org; 12 Sep 2023 17:46:36 +0000
Return-Path: <mark@hindley.org.uk>
Delivered-To: bugs@devuan.org
Received: from email.devuan.org [2a01:4f8:140:32a1::58c6:6473]
	by doc.devuan.org with IMAP (fetchmail-6.4.16)
	for <debbugs@localhost> (single-drop); Tue, 12 Sep 2023 17:46:36 +0000 (UTC)
Received: from email.devuan.org
	by email.devuan.org with LMTP
	id 5/rrBbGjAGXofAAAmSBk0A
	(envelope-from <mark@hindley.org.uk>)
	for <bugs@devuan.org>; Tue, 12 Sep 2023 17:45:21 +0000
Received: by email.devuan.org (Postfix, from userid 109)
	id 034DC1F7; Tue, 12 Sep 2023 17:45:20 +0000 (UTC)
X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on email.devuan.org
X-Spam-Level: 
X-Spam-Status: No, score=0.4 required=5.0 tests=RDNS_DYNAMIC,SPF_PASS
	autolearn=no autolearn_force=no version=3.4.6
Received-SPF: Pass (mailfrom) identity=mailfrom; client-ip=193.36.131.86; helo=mx.hindley.org.uk; envelope-from=mark@hindley.org.uk; receiver=<UNKNOWN> 
Received: from mx.hindley.org.uk (193-36-131-86.cfwn.uk [193.36.131.86])
	by email.devuan.org (Postfix) with ESMTPS id AAF0481
	for <793@bugs.devuan.org>; Tue, 12 Sep 2023 17:45:20 +0000 (UTC)
Received: from hindley.org.uk (apollo.hindleynet [192.168.1.3])
	by mx.hindley.org.uk (Postfix) with SMTP id 2642BFAD;
	Tue, 12 Sep 2023 18:45:20 +0100 (BST)
Received: (nullmailer pid 30634 invoked by uid 1000);
	Tue, 12 Sep 2023 17:45:20 -0000
Date: Tue, 12 Sep 2023 18:45:19 +0100
From: Mark Hindley <mark@hindley.org.uk>
To: Fran Vazquez <fran42@gmx.es>, 793@bugs.devuan.org
Subject: Re: bug#793: libseat fails to access logind backend
Message-ID: <ZQCjr3d3E0t0iJeW@hindley.org.uk>
References: <70507bba-f6da-40e9-d7f2-2256b7ae7fcc@gmail.com>
 <trinity-ed5e720f-9b78-403c-9e14-98746a2f3218-1694518751994@3c-app-mailcom-bs07>
 <70507bba-f6da-40e9-d7f2-2256b7ae7fcc@gmail.com>
 <ZQCdDVbKk4W7bOvD@hindley.org.uk>
MIME-Version: 1.0
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
In-Reply-To: <ZQCdDVbKk4W7bOvD@hindley.org.uk>
X-Debbugs-No-Ack: No Thanks
Control: tags -1 moreinfo
Control: found -1 2:21.1.7-3devuan2~exp1

Fran

Libseat talks to the elogind backend over dbus. I find it hard to see how polkit
can facilitate or enable that.

Please can you post the Xorg.log showing the failure (without polkitd and
without the user in input group).

Thanks

Mark

Send a report that this bug log contains spam.


Devuan BTS -- Powered by Debian bug tracking system
Copyright (C) 1999 Darren O. Benham,
1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son,
2005-2017 Don Armstrong, and many other contributors.

Devuan Bugs Owner <owner@bugs.devuan.org>.
Last modified: Sat Oct 25 20:38:23 2025;